What Is Structured Data?

Structured data is a standardized format for organizing and describing information on a webpage. It provides search engines with structured, machine-readable details about specific content elements, such as articles, products, organizations, events, and local businesses.

Structured data is commonly implemented using schema markup based on the Schema.org vocabulary, a collaborative framework supported by major search engines. It can be added to a webpage in several formats, with JSON-LD recommended by Google.

Structured data, schema markup, and rich results are closely related but not interchangeable terms. Structured data refers to standardized information used to describe webpage content, while schema markup is the code that implements it using the Schema.org vocabulary. When search engines successfully process structured data, certain pages may become eligible for rich results, which are enhanced search listings that display additional information directly in search results.

It is important to note that structured data does not guarantee rich results. Search engines evaluate multiple factors before deciding whether enhanced search features will appear.

In simple terms, structured data helps define what certain pieces of information on a webpage represent, making that information easier for search engines to process and categorize.

Why Structured Data Is Important for SEO

Structured data helps search engines understand, categorize, and display webpage content more accurately. Although it is not a direct ranking factor, it can improve how content appears in search results, support content discoverability, and provide clearer signals about the information on a page.

Helps Search Engines Understand Your Content Better

Not all webpage content is easy for search engines to interpret. Structured data provides explicit labels indicating whether a page contains a product, article, event, organization, or another content type. This additional context reduces ambiguity and helps search engines classify information more accurately.

Enhances Search Visibility with Rich Results

Structured data can make webpages eligible for rich results, which display additional information directly in search listings. Depending on the schema used, this may include review ratings, product details, breadcrumbs, article information, business details, and other enhancements that make listings more informative.

Can Support Better Click-Through Rates

Rich results often occupy more space and provide more context than standard search listings. By displaying useful information before a user clicks, they may increase visibility and encourage higher click-through rates from relevant searches.

Supports Technical SEO and Content Discoverability

Structured data adds a machine-readable layer of information that helps search engines process and organize content more effectively. While it is only one part of SEO, alongside factors such as content quality and domain-related considerations, it helps create a stronger foundation for search visibility.

Modern search engines increasingly rely on entities, relationships, and contextual understanding. Structured data helps define these elements in a standardized format, making content easier for AI-powered search systems to interpret and connect with relevant user queries.

Common Types of Structured Data Used on Websites

Different types of structured data describe different kinds of content. Some of the most commonly used schema types include:

  • Article Schema: Used for blog posts, news articles, and editorial content. It can identify details such as the headline, author, publication date, and featured image.
  • Organization Schema: Provides information about a company or organization, including its name, logo, website, and contact details.
  • Local Business Schema: Used by businesses that serve specific locations. It can include the business name, address, phone number, operating hours, and service area.
  • Product Schema: Commonly used on e-commerce websites to provide details such as product name, price, availability, ratings, and other product information.
  • FAQ Schema: Used for pages with frequently asked questions and answers, helping search engines better understand the structure of the content. Although FAQ Schema remains a valid type of structured data, the display of FAQ Rich Results is now limited across many website categories, so its implementation does not guarantee enhanced visibility in Google search results.
  • Breadcrumb Schema: Defines a page's location within a website hierarchy and helps search engines understand site structure and navigation paths.

Structured Data Best Practices

To get the most value from structured data, follow these best practices:

  • Use the appropriate schema type: Match the schema markup to the content on the page. For example, use Product Schema for product pages and Article Schema for blog posts.
  • Follow Schema.org standards: Use recognized schema types and properties to ensure consistency and compatibility across search engines.
  • Use JSON-LD whenever possible: JSON-LD is Google's recommended format for implementing structured data.
  • Keep information accurate and up to date: Structured data should reflect the page's actual content, including details such as pricing, availability, business information, and publication dates.
  • Validate your markup regularly: Testing structured data helps identify errors, missing properties, and implementation issues that could affect search engine interpretation.
  • Avoid misleading or irrelevant markup: Only mark up content that is visible and relevant to users. Inaccurate schema markup may prevent eligibility for certain search enhancements.
